A fantastic opportunity has arisen to lead the Merchandising function at Whistles. You'll be responsible for driving commercial performance through data-led decision making, strategic planning and strong cross-functional collaboration.
Reporting directly to our Commercial Director, the Head of Merchandising role is central to delivering sales, profit and stock targets. You'll lead the end-to-end merchandising strategy, from planning through to in-season trading, shaping decisions that directly impact business performance. This role is a key part of the brand leadership team, contributing to the wider strategic direction of the business. You'll work closely with Buying, Design, Finance and wider stakeholders, playing an active role in influencing decisions and delivering against our commercial objectives.

Who you'll be:
To be successful in this role, you'll bring the following skills & experience:
- Extensive experience leading merchandising functions with a strong track record of delivering sales, profit and stock targets, and influencing overall business performance
- Proven ability to translate topline financial goals into clear, actionable departmental plans, with strong ownership of WSSI, forecasting and in-season trading
- Highly analytical with the ability to use data, insights and performance metrics to inform decisions, identify opportunities and mitigate risks
- Deep understanding of OTB management, intake planning, markdown strategy and margin optimisation across multiple channels
- An inclusive and motivating leader who builds capability, drives performance and supports the development of high-performing teams
- Strong stakeholder management skills with the ability to build effective relationships across Buying, Design, Finance, DC, Retail and E-commerce
- Experience driving change, improving processes and implementing new ways of working to enhance efficiency and business outcomes
- Strong understanding of multi-channel trading, including retail, e-commerce, wholesale and international markets
